Appealed from the District Court of Harris County, 174th Judicial District No. 976064, Honorable George S. Godwin, Judge Presiding. Dismissed for Want of Jurisdiction.

Before Chief Justice JONES, Justices PURYEAR and HENSON.


MEMORANDUM OPINION


Appellant Jose Jesus Franco, acting pro se, filed his notice of appeal in this Court on January 5, 2009. Upon receipt of the notice of appeal, this Court notified Flores of his responsibility to provide a docketing statement. See Tex. R. App. P. 32.2. Flores subsequently provided a docketing statement, which revealed that the judgment of conviction in this case was rendered by a Harris County district court. Harris County is not located in the Third Court of Appeals district. Consequently, we are without jurisdiction to consider Flores's appeal. This appeal is dismissed for want of jurisdiction.
